Need Help on Installing Ear/Mic cables to Motherboard...

First of all, I have the P5W DH Deluxe board and a Thermaltake Soprano case. The case has an ear/mic cable which runs from the top of the case down to the motherboard, etc. I know where I need to plug the connectors in on the motherboard in order to make it work, however, I cannot figure out the proper configuration of the 6-pins for the connector. The Asus “conversion” guide supplied by Thermaltake does not 100% match the layout the motherboard user guide gives me. This is what the motherboard gives me in terms of pinconnections:

For HD Audio:
SENSE2_RETUR
SENSE1_RETUR
PRESENCE#
GND
PORT2 L
SENSE_SEND
PORT2 R
PORT1 R
PORT1 L

For Legacy AC 97:
NC
NC
NC
AGND
Line out_L
NC
Line out_R
MIC2_R
MIC2_L

The pins coming from the jacks in the case are the following:

EAR R
Return R
EAR L
Return L
MIC IN
MIC VCC
Ground

And according the the conersion guide the following should work:

EAR R should go with LINE_OUT R
EAR L should go with LINE_OUT L
Ground with Ground

What about the other 4 pins? The guide does not give a direct translation of those.

What I understands with this is

EAR R - line out R
Return R - Line in R
EAR L - Line out L
Return L - Line in L
MIC IN - both Mic_Right and Mic_Left
MIC VCC - There should be something like VCC port in your sound coz this provide power to the Mic. (VCC - common-collector voltage)
Ground - Ground
